The phrase "which could otherwise"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it to suggest that something has the potential for a different result or outcome than what is currently happening. For example, "The city was working on new safety guidelines for public areas, which could otherwise lead to increased levels of security."

But like ethanol, producing biodiesel requires farmland, which could otherwise be used to raise food.
That means there is a significant spillover by these vehicles into metered and unmetered spots, which could otherwise be used by the public.
Subsidies also distort world market prices for vegetables, cut flowers and cereal grains, many of which could otherwise be marketed competitively by third world countries.
Most of the crop's nutritional content (which could otherwise have gone to feed humans) is thereby effectively converted into faeces, inedible tissue and heat.
The carrier says it charges so much in such circumstances to thwart screen-scraping software, which could otherwise book tickets under false names and then sell them on.
"The resulting cost to borrowers can be thousands of dollars in taxes which could otherwise be easily avoided," Mr. Wasser said.
Piling up reserves for this purpose has been a costly business for developing nations, which could otherwise invest those funds in their own economies – and earn a much higher rate of return.
Later, when times got hard, during droughts or climate changes, it helped us deal with these crises, which could otherwise have killed us off, by dreaming up novel ideas to problems.
So it's worth noting that anabolic steroids not only helped Canseco turn into a home-run-hitting monster but also, he says, allowed him to recuperate from a series of back surgeries which could otherwise have ended his career.
Leonard Koren, who writes books about design and aesthetics, said that for a relationship to thrive in close quarters, the couple must acquiesce to the constraints of the space, which could otherwise grind them down.
This approach could potentially lead to unnecessary travel cost which could otherwise have been avoided.
